Sources say business secretary ‘didn’t want a meeting and didn’t ask for one’
The business secretary, Andrea Leadsom, has come under fire after it emerged she did not speak to Thomas Cook executives during increasingly frantic talks between the company and the government leading up to its collapse last week.
Records of telephone calls and meetings, seen by the Guardian, indicate that there was widespread awareness among government ministers that the 178-year-old tour operator’s finances were deteriorating for months prior to its failure. Continue reading...
